利用Redis提升请求路由效率(redis 请求路由)
2023-06-13 09:12:52 时间
的尝试
最近,我们系统正在进行一些应用上的改动,致力于优化服务质量,使用户能够更好的使用体验。为此,在系统的设计和架构中,在考虑如何提升请求路由的处理效率。
一般来说,请求路由的效率主要取决于路由运算的处理速度和后端资源稳定性两个方面,一般我们有以下几种解决办法:
利用缓存技术,把常用的请求路由信息存储到内存中,避免不必要的路由重算操作,提升请求处理的效率。
调整短连接的请求等,优化客户端和服务端之间的交互,以提高系统效率。
改善存储系统,以降低后端资源查询和更新操作的速度,避免请求进入应用层之前出现拥堵,从而有效提升系统效率。
我们也把Redis考虑到了优化策略中,因为Redis在读写方面执行效率超高、内存占用低,对外部存储器友好,更重要的是它提供了各种丰富的数据类型,可以方便的存储和访问已被路由处理的数据,从而加快系统的请求路由处理速度。举个例子,我们可以采用以下代码:
// 将前端传入的参数存入Redis:
redis.set("params", params, "EX",60*60*2);
// 后端从Redis获取路由参数:let params = redis.get("params");
// 开始处理路由router.render(params);
以上就是我们尝试利用Redis提升请求路由效率的基本思路,优化的策略因场景而异,可以根据我们的实际需求,结合Redis的特性来更合理的实施,从而提升系统的性能和用户的体验。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 利用Redis提升请求路由效率(redis 请求路由)
相关文章
- Redis模糊查询:提升性能的不二选择(redis模糊查询性能)
- 实现Redis视频推荐系统(redis视频推荐)
- Python玩转Redis:提升缓存效率(python使用redis)
- Redis应用于抢单场景,提高交易效率(redis抢单)
- 利用Redis提高缓存效率:优雅的刷新缓存命令(redis刷新缓存命令)
- 者Redis消费者:提升业务效率的动力(redis消费)
- 缓存微擎利用Redis内存缓存提升运行效率(微擎redis内存)
- 从Redis中循环取出数据提升效率的必由之路(循环从redis取出数据)
- 优化库存管理用Redis提升效率(库存用redis)
- 紧抓机会快来领取Redis优惠券(领取优惠券redis)
- 监测Redis性能,获取实时状态数据(监控redis状态数据)
- 使用Redis做登录系统提升安全性和效率(用redis做登陆系统)
- sftp无缝对接Redis,提升运维效能(sftp对接redis)
- 用Redis实现三标联动,提升技术效率(使用redis做三标联动)
- 后盾网基于Redis极大提升开发效率(后盾网redis)
- REDIS面试指南一份丰富的笔记(redis面试笔记)
- Redis集群实现路由构建与调度(redis集群如何路由)
- 深入浅出Redis集群与SET集合(redis集群set集合)
- 精益求精Redis运维技术助力优化(redis运维功能)
- 从Redis路由法则看数据分发(redis路由法则)
- Redis中的超时机制一个必要的规则(redis超时规则)
- Redis集群最少配置3台服务器(redis集群单数台)
- 使用Redis提升数据获取效率(redis 获取数据效率)
- Redis瞬间获取数据IO,提升运行效率(redis获取数据io)